Analysis

In 2021, total natural resources rents in Republic of Korea stood at 0.0%.

The figure is down 56.0% on the previous year and down 45.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, total natural resources rents in Republic of Korea peaked at 0.8% in 1975 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 1993.

That places Republic of Korea 165th out of 212 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Total natural resources rents are the sum of oil rents, natural gas rents, coal rents (hard and soft), mineral rents, and forest rents.
